排序
IntelliJ IDEA集成Git仓库的详细实现步骤
一、环境准备阶段 1.1 Git安装验证 # 检查Git是否安装成功 git --version # 配置全局用户信息 git config --global user.name 'Your Name' git config --global user.email 'your.email@example...
CommandLineRunner 最佳实践深度解析
一、核心机制剖析 1.1 执行时机图示 sequenceDiagram SpringApplication->>CommandLineRunner: 1. 启动完成 CommandLineRunner->>ApplicationContext: 2. 完全初始化 CommandLineRunner->>业务...
Java HTTPS请求失败排查与证书导入全流程指南
一、HTTPS请求失败常见现象 1.1 典型错误类型 pie title HTTPS错误分布 '证书验证失败' : 55 '协议版本不匹配' : 20 '证书过期' : 15 '主机名不匹配' : 10 1.2 常见异常信息 异常类型触发原因解...
pyautogui库的使用及说明
pyautogui 是一个强大的 Python 库,用于自动化控制鼠标和键盘,常用于 GUI 自动化测试、游戏脚本、办公自动化等场景。 1. 安装 pyautogui pip install pyautogui 注意:在 Linux 系统...
Spring创建Bean的多种方式对比与最佳实践
在Spring框架中,Bean是应用程序的核心组件,其创建方式直接影响代码的可维护性、灵活性和设计质量。Spring提供了多种创建Bean的方式,每种方式适用于不同的场景。本文将系统对比这些方式,并结...
Git推送代码遭遇403 Forbidden错误的原因和解决方法
当你在使用Git推送代码到远程仓库(如GitHub、GitLab、Gitee等)时,如果遇到 '403 Forbidden' 错误,通常意味着你的请求被服务器拒绝,你没有足够的权限向该仓库执行推送操作。这是...
Git子模块拉取操作的完整指南
在大型软件开发项目中,代码复用与模块化协作是提升效率的关键。Git子模块(Submodule)作为一种将外部仓库嵌入主项目的机制,允许开发者将独立的Git仓库(如公共库、第三方依赖或团队共享模块...
MySQL字符串转数值的方法全解析
好的,我们来对 MySQL 中字符串转数值的各种方法进行全方位解析。这在处理从文本字段(如 VARCHAR)中提取数字进行计算或比较时非常常见。 核心方法概览 MySQL 提供了多种函数来处理字符串到数...









